Classic American Popular Song: The Second Half-Century, 1950-2000 addresses the question: What happened to American popular song after 1950? There are numerous books available on the so-called Golden Age of popular song, but none that follow the development of popular song styles in the second half of the 20th century. While 1950 is seen as the end of an era, the tap of popular song creation hardly ran dry after that date. Many of the classic songwriters continued to work through the following decades; Porter was active until 1958; Rodgers until the later 1970s; Arlen until 1976. Some of the greatest lyricists of the classic era continued to do outstanding american century music popular and successful work: Johnny Mercer american century music popular and Dorothy Fields, for example, continued to produce lyrics through the early `70s. These works could be explained as simply the Golden Age`s last stand, a refusal of major figures to give in to a new reality. But then, how explain the outstanding careers of Frank Loesser, Cy Coleman, Jerry Herman, Jerry Bock american century music popular and Sheldon Harnick, Fred Kander american century music popular and John Ebb, Jules Styne, Alan Jay Lerner american century music popular and Frederick Loewe, american century music popular and several other major figures? Where did Stephen Sondheim come from? This book tackles the issue head on, answering questions like: Was there a decline in quality or quantity of pop song after 1950? Were the highly successful writers who emerged after 1950 working in an antiquated style? Did they, perhaps, adopt new musical american century music popular and verse techniques, american century music popular and thus shape a new genre--perhaps to be judged later, in retrospect, as a new classic style? Lipstick Traces: A Secret History of the 20th Century - Lipstick Traces: A Secret History of the 20th Century (1989), is a non-fiction book by American rock-music critic Greil Marcus that examines popular music and art as a social critique of Western culture. A theatrical version played off-Broadway in 2001.

American popular music - Starting with the birth of recorded music, American popular music has had a profound effect on music across the world. The country has seen the rise of popular styles that have had a significant influence on global culture, including ragtime, blues, jazz, rock, R & B, doo wop, gospel, soul, funk, heavy metal, punk, disco, house, techno, salsa, grunge and hip hop.

American Music Awards of 2004 - The 32nd annual American Music Awards were held on November 14, 2004 (see 2004 in music). The awards recognized the most popular artists and albums from the year 2004.

Anglo-American music - The Thirteen Colonies of the original United States were all former English possessions, and Anglo culture became a major foundation for American folk and popular music.
